RUFUS BRATTON-CAPTURED NAZI DOCUMENTS
Superb collection of relics from the archive of Colonel Rufus Bratton, the Army infantry and intelligence officer whose work as Far East Section Chief of Military Intelligence and actions during the Pearl Harbor attack were fictionalized in the movie Tora Tora Tora: a grouping of various stationery and other documents Bratton took from Nazi offices while serving as Headquarters Commandant in Patton's Third Army, then occupying Berlin. Included is a 4" x 6" red "Ausweis" card, a stamped and signed pass for crossing German lines, a blank piece of 4to. stationery from the offices of Gestapo-head HEINRICH MULLER, and a decorative SS award for excellent shooting proficiency dated Oct. 22, 1938, stamped and signed. Also included is a yellow "Death's Head" banner measuring 4" x 5", blank letterhead for "Der Reichsfuhrer--SS", "Der Chef der Sicherheitspolizei und des SD" and "Kanzlei des Fuhrers der NSDAP",
